The World's Best is not the hit CBS was hoping for. 

The new reality series which aims to find the most talented individuals in the world languished in its Wednesday time-period debut with 5.6 million total viewers and a 1.0 rating.

It launched on Sunday out of the Super Bowl with 22.2 million viewers and a 7.0 rating. 

These are probably way off from what CBS expected, and given the scale of the series, it can't be a cheap one to produce. 

It's already on the bubble with these numbers.

Meanwhile, the season finale of Criminal Minds was steady with 4.7 million total viewers and a 0.8 rating. 

Over on The CW, Riverdale slipped to its lowest ratings of the season with 1 million viewers and a 0.3 rating. 

All American followed and was steady with 0.6 million total viewers and a 0.2 rating.

Chicago Med (9.3 million/1.4 rating), Chicago Fire (8.8 million/1.3 rating), and Chicago PD (7.4 million/1.2 rating) were all up in the demo vs. their last originals. 

Over on Fox, The Masked Singer slipped four-tenths to 7.1 million total viewers and a 2.2 rating. 

Gordon Ramsey's 24 Hours was down just one-tenth to 3.8 million total viewers and a 1.1 rating.
